FCGAX Mutual Fund Overview

FCGAX Mutual Fund (Franklin Growth Fund Advisor Class) is managed by Franklin Templeton Investments (US) with $3.20B in net assets. FCGAX expense ratio is 0.52%, holding 92 positions across sectors including Information Technology, Industrials, Health Care. Inception date: 1996-12-31.

FCGAX performance shows a YTD return of 6.06%. The 1-year return is 11.96% and the 5-year return is 8.71%. FCGAX dividend yield stands at 0.22%, paid annually.
